Transaction 1933e7871b06e7653af6bfb3cf710e05d32cb14a1b9cabeb01fc987f3ada71c5
1 Input
1 Output
-
1933e7871b06e7653af6bfb3cf710e05d32cb14a1b9cabeb01fc987f3ada71c5:0
- value
- 2058896
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f42f1223f532b81918b8916b624519cc1e8629fe OP_EQUAL
- address
- 3Px9Bte57SU58FoQpa3JnxruZYSZeevHwx